Age of Extinction leads the 2015 Razzies Nominations

Posted by Burn Jan 15, 2015 at 2:24am CST 35,603 views
The final nominations are out and Optimus Prime riding Grimlock is leading the charge as Transformers:Age of Extinction leads The 2015 Razzies Nomination list with SEVEN nominations.

The full list of nominees is as follows:

Worst Picture
•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as
• Left Behind
• The Legend of Hercules
•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les
Transformers: Age of Extinction

Worst Actor
• Kirk Cameron -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as
• Nicolas Cage - Left Behind
• Kellan Lutz - The Legend of Hercules
• Seth MacFarlane - A Million Ways to Die in the West
• Adam Sandler - Blended

Worst Supporting Actor
• Mel Gibson - The Expendables 3
Kelsey Grammer - The Expendables 3, Legends of Oz, Think Like a Man Too, Transformers: Age of Extinction
• Shaquille O'Neal - Blended
• Arnold Schwarzenegger - The Expendables 3
• Kiefer Sutherland - Pompeii

Worst Actress
• Drew Barrymore - Blended
• Cameron Diaz - The Other Woman and Sex Tape
• Melissa McCarthy - Tammy
• Charlize Theron - A Million Ways to Die in the West
• Gaia Weiss - The Legend of Hercules

Worst Supporting Actress
• Cameron Diaz - Annie
• Megan Fox -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les
Nicola Peltz - Transformers: Age of Extinction
• Susan Sarandon - Tammy
• Brigitte Ridenour (nee Cameron) -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as

Worst Director
Michael Bay - Transformers: Age of Extinction
• Darren Doane -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as
• Renny Harlin - The Legend of Hercules
• Jonathan Liebesman -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les
• Seth MacFarlane - A Million Ways to Die in the West

Worst Remake, Rip-off or Sequel
• Annie
• Atlas Shrugged: Who Is John Galt?
• The Legend of Hercules
•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les
Transformers: Age of Extinction

Worst Screen Combo
Any Two Robots, Actors (Robotic Actors) - Transformers: Age of Extinction
• Kirk Cameron and His Ego -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as
• Cameron Diaz and Jason Segel - Sex Tape
• Kellan Lutz and Either His Abs, His Pecs or His Glutes - The Legend of Hercules
• Seth MacFarlane and Charlize Theron - A Million Ways to Die in the West

Worst Screenplay
• Kirk Cameron's Saving Christmas
• Left Behind
• Sex Tape
•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les
Transformers: Age of Extinction

Redeemer Award
• Ben Affleck - from Gigli to Argo and Gone Girl
• Jennifer Aniston - from four-time Razzie nominee to Cake
• Mike Myers - from The Love Guru to directing Supermensch
• Keanu Reeves - from six-time Razzie nominee to John Wick
• Kristen Stewart - from six-time Razzie winner for Twilight to Camp X-Ray
